I appear to have 2 versions of messenger on my computer,
or 1 version that works 2 different ways.

If I go onto messenger 6.2 through start>messenger 6.2,
everything works fine. If I go onto messenger any other
way, clicking system tray icon or through hotmail, I only
get half a product with the web cam and audio not working
and I get prompted to upgrade messenger. If I do this it
works ok for that visit but then returns to normal

Greetings Les,

Actually on Windows XP, you can have two Messenger clients installed -- Windows Messenger 4.x
which comes with Windows XP and MSN Messenger 6.x, which you install separately.

You should however, see MSN Messenger 6.2 in the notification area/system tray as well. You
may want to disable Windows Messenger from starting and tell MSN Messenger 6.2 to start
instead. To do so, open Windows Messenger up (click Start, then Run, type "msmsgs" and click
OK), click Tools, Options, Preferences tab and uncheck 'Run this Program when Windows starts'
or 'Run Windows Messenger when Windows starts' (depending on version) as well as 'Allow this
program to run in the background' or 'Allow Windows Messenger to run in the background'
(depending on version).

Then start MSN Messenger 6.2, click the Tools menu, then Options, then General tab, and make
sure that the "Automatically run Messenger when I log on to Windows" is selected.
